The name “stadium” comes from the ancient Greek unit of length, equivalent to about 600 feet or 184.96 meters, which was also the length of this stadium.
More facts about the Oldest Olympic Stadium
After the Roman Empire fell, the panathenaic stadium fell into disuse and much of its marble was looted. In 1895, a wealthy entrepreneur funded a full restoration using white marble, which was completed in 1900.
The stadium was originally built to host the Panathenaic Games, a festival honoring the goddess Athena. It also hosted the first modern Olympic Games in 1896 and is the starting point of the Olympic flame torch relay.
